Professional reviewers, while limited in number, emphasize that the Wyze Cam OG delivers a noticeable performance boost over earlier Wyze cameras, particularly through its faster motion alerts and smoother livestreams. The inclusion of a built‑in spotlight and robust color night vision are also highlighted as differentiators in the budget segment.
Everyday users consistently commend the camera’s night‑vision quality, weather durability, and straightforward installation. The most common complaints revolve around the wired power requirement and occasional confusion about the exact field‑of‑view angle, but overall sentiment is positive for a low‑cost security solution.

Professional reviewers describe the Ring Spotlight Cam Plus Battery as a versatile security camera suitable for various outdoor locations, capable of capturing reasonably clear video. While the feature set including HD video, dual night vision, siren, and LED spotlights justifies its mid-range positioning, the image quality is considered a limiting factor due to pixelation and edge distortion inherent in the wide-angle lens.
Everyday users appreciate the flexible mounting capabilities and the ease of installation, making it suitable for those avoiding permanent wiring. The quick-release battery system is highly valued for its convenience, and the motion-activated lights are noted for their deterrent effect. Users generally find the battery performance aligns with the expected lifespan, supporting the typical three-month charge cycle.

Professional reviewers highlight the Vision Well's strong value proposition for budget-conscious users, praising its wire-free convenience, effective AI filtering, and clear video quality. However, significant criticisms focus on the slow motion detection response time, which fails to capture rapid movements, and persistent WiFi connectivity issues. While the 2K model offers competitive features like 360° pan, the overall reliability is viewed as mixed, with some editors warning against purchase due to long-term performance concerns.
Everyday users generally appreciate the long battery life, clear picture quality, and ease of setup, noting that the AI detection helps reduce false alerts from passing cars. However, recurring complaints center on unreliable motion detection that misses close movements, frequent WiFi disconnects, and app glitches. Many users feel that the initial excitement fades as they encounter consistency issues and faster battery drain in high-activity areas.

Professional reviewers, including PCMag, have awarded the Tapo C120 an Editor's Choice rating for 2024, praising its crystal-clear 1440p video quality and accurate free AI detection for people, pets, and vehicles. Reviewers highlight the camera's excellent color night vision, flexible storage options, and clear two-way audio as standout features that deliver premium performance without requiring a subscription.
Everyday users generally praise the Tapo C120 for its sharp 2K clarity, vibrant night vision, and reliable AI notifications. Common themes include appreciation for the easy setup, magnetic mounting flexibility, and clear audio quality. Recurring complaints focus on the need for wired power proximity and the separate purchase of microSD cards, with some users noting a slight learning curve with the app interface.

Professional reviewers, including PCMag, have awarded the Wyze Cam Floodlight Pro an Editors' Choice award, praising it as an affordable yet powerful security solution. Experts highlight the 180° field of view and 2.5K resolution as key strengths for comprehensive coverage. The onboard AI computer vision is specifically noted as a significant technological advancement over traditional passive infrared (PIR) motion detection systems found in older models.

Professional reviewers highlight the Wyze Battery Cam Pro as Wyze's best wireless outdoor camera, praising its superior 2.5K resolution, color night vision, and accurate radar+PIR motion detection. Editors note enhanced clarity over prior models like the Wyze Cam Outdoor v2 and appreciate the no-base station setup, though some scrutinize battery life in heavy-use scenarios.
Everyday users commonly praise the sharp 2.5K color night vision, reliable motion alerts, and easy battery swaps. Strong two-way audio is appreciated for pet monitoring and deterrence. Recurring complaints focus on battery life falling short of the 6-month claim during frequent use, occasional 5GHz WiFi connectivity issues, and app dependency.

Professional reviewers and editors highlight the Nest Cam with Floodlight as a solid wired option, praising its strong 1080p HDR video quality, reliable intelligent alerts, and effective floodlight performance without video washout. Consumer Reports and other experts rate it highly for outdoor use due to its IP54 rating and comprehensive smart features like geofencing and 2-way audio, noting it is a reliable choice for the Google ecosystem.
Everyday consumers generally praise the bright floodlights for enabling clear color night footage and the accurate motion detection capabilities. Users appreciate the easy setup within the Google Home app and the reliability of alerts for packages and vehicles. However, recurring complaints focus on the difficulty of electrical installation, occasional app glitches, the inconvenience of charging the internal battery, and a desire for higher video resolution.
